A flurry of activity was undertaken over 24 and 25 May as the SHHS Year 7 and Year 11 da Vinci Decathlon teams battled 3200 other students in the state championships. For the second year in a row students participated in an online environment uploading challenging academic papers in Mathematics, Science, English and others, art works were created, and engineering models built, as well as videos of enthusiastic dramatic performances.
Teamwork and resiliency were evident as every task was completed to the best of students’ ability. Team results and overall finalists are released on Friday 3 June at 7:45am and SHHS students are invited to attend the presentations being broadcast in the school’s Lecture Theatre.
Regardless of the outcome, students who participated built valuable skills and knowledge while having fun and realising their personal best.
